There are several educational requirements to become a development geologist. Development geologists usually study geology, geological engineering, or chemistry. 73% of development geologists hold a bachelor's degree, and 23% hold an master's degree. | Rank | Major | Percentages |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| Geology | 84.8% |
| 2 | Geological Engineering | 4.7% |
| 3 | Chemistry | 1.6% |
| 4 | Mathematics | 1.0% |
| 5 | Engineering | 1.0% |

| Development geologist education level | Development geologist salary |
|---|---|
| Master's Degree | $125,233 |
| Bachelor's Degree | $107,432 |
| Doctorate Degree | $140,470 |
